* Many Detailed Statistics are based on play-by-play accounts accumulated by RetroSheet. These totals may be incomplete (3.6% of all plays from 1954 to 1973 are missing or have incomplete accounts, click link for year and team summary) for some players prior to 1974 and even complete seasons may not match the official totals due to errors in both the official totals and the play-by-play accounts.
